Essential Components of a Medical Malpractice Claim

To establish a medical malpractice claim, it is necessary to prove four key elements: duty, breach, causation, and damages. This means showing that a healthcare provider owed a duty to the patient, failed in that duty, directly caused injury, and that the injury resulted in measurable harm. Important Terms to Know About Medical Malpractice

Understanding key legal and medical terms can help Big Rapids residents navigate their medical malpractice case with greater confidence. Below is a glossary of terms commonly used in these claims.

Standard of Care

The level and type of care that a reasonably competent healthcare provider would provide under similar circumstances in Big Rapids. It serves as the benchmark for evaluating whether malpractice has occurred.

Causation

The direct link between the healthcare provider’s breach of duty and the injury sustained by the patient. Proving causation is crucial in a medical malpractice claim in Michigan.

Negligence

Failure to exercise the care that a reasonably prudent healthcare provider would use, which leads to patient harm. Negligence is a central concept in medical malpractice cases.

Damages

Monetary compensation awarded to a patient for losses suffered due to medical malpractice, including medical bills, lost income, and pain and suffering.

In Michigan, the statute of limitations for filing a medical malpractice claim generally requires action within two years from the date the injury was discovered or should have been discovered. There are exceptions and nuances depending on the case specifics. For residents of Big Rapids, adhering to these deadlines is crucial to preserving your legal rights. Because these timeframes can be complex, consulting with legal counsel early in the process can help ensure timely filing and avoid potential dismissal of your claim for procedural reasons.

Michigan follows a comparative negligence rule, which means you may still pursue a medical malpractice claim even if you are partially at fault. However, your compensation may be reduced proportionally based on your share of responsibility. Understanding how this applies to your specific case is important.
